Unbeaten Cougars Blast Lake Region State College 20-2
Frederick Community College Cougars baseball continued its dominant start to the 2026 season on Tuesday afternoon, powering past Lake Region State College–ND with a 20–2 victory in Davenport, Florida. Now five games into their RussMatt Baseball: College Baseball Invitational slate, the Cougars remain unbeaten at 5–0.
Frederick came out firing with four runs in the opening frame, built the lead with another in the second, and broke the game wide open with a nine-run third inning that put Lake Region on its heels for good.
The Cougars' offense delivered top to bottom, piling up 15 hits and 17 RBI. Casey Westerberg reached base four times and drove in a pair, while Cole Swinimer set the tone at the top with two hits and three stolen bases. Hunter Lee and Braydon Kelman both launched home runs as part of six combined RBI, and Jack Kerns added a late blast of his own. Luis Perez Alfaro doubled twice and drove in a run, and Vincenzo Cusat and Clayton Dorsey each added two RBI to the outburst, helping Frederick pull away inning after inning.
Frederick's pitching remained steady throughout the afternoon. Starter Zach Bortner opened with two hitless innings, Daniel Jakubowyc worked the middle frames with the only two runs allowed, and Niko ThaLassinos earned the win with two scoreless innings and three strikeouts. Matthew Calabrese closed the door with a clean final inning.
